Pete Swanson Bio
Pete Swanson is a Senior Partner at Impact Associates. With nearly 40 years of extensive experience across both domestic and international settings, he has helped a wide variety of clients achieve effective business outcomes. He specializes in blending conflict resolution, leadership development, coaching, organizational development, and training to provide systemic, holistic approaches to challenges. His work focuses on enhancing communication and connection within organizations. Mr. Swanson is an accomplished mediator, coach, facilitator, trainer, and consultant, particularly in leadership development, alignment, and systemic change.
Over the past two decades, Mr. Swanson has been at the forefront of conflict resolution, leadership development, and complex organizational change. He has worked with over 50 federal, state, local, and international agencies and organizations across four continents and 25 countries, including Afghanistan, Argentina, Austria, Bosnia, Bulgaria, Croatia, Cyprus, the Dominican Republic, Guatemala, Greece, the Netherlands, India, Japan, Korea, Kosovo, Myanmar, Nepal, Panama, Papua New Guinea, Serbia, Slovenia, Sweden, and Thailand. His expertise covers mediation training, facilitation, dispute systems design, and leadership development.
Mr. Swanson frequently mediates and facilitates workplace conflicts of all sizes, leads senior executive leadership programs, and drives culture change initiatives for federal agencies and other organizations. He also provides executive coaching to senior leaders. As a course designer and lead trainer, he has taught over 3,000 students in hundreds of courses focused on mediation, leadership, negotiation, and facilitation. He has coached numerous leaders in challenging environments, helping them enhance communication and negotiation skills to foster deeper connections and transform adversarial relationships into productive partnerships.
Until March 2025, Mr. Swanson served at the Federal Mediation and Conciliation Service (FMCS), where he led high-profile national and international projects. He also founded and directed the Conflict Management Professional Program, aimed at developing FMCS staff to deliver comprehensive conflict management and prevention services for agency clients, alongside managing FMCS’s international portfolio. From 2018 to 2024, he was the Manager for Conflict Management and Prevention/International at FMCS, overseeing interagency agreements and activities with other federal agencies.
Before rejoining FMCS in 2018, Mr. Swanson was a senior partner at Carr Swanson & Randolph, LLC, for 18 years. Mr. Swanson began his career at FMCS, where he served from 1989 to 2001 as a Commissioner/ADR mediator and a training specialist in mediation and facilitation. He played a key role in developing FMCS’s domestic and international alternative dispute resolution programs and served as a mediator in numerous public policy, tribal-federal, environmental, labor, grant, employment, EEO, and environmental disputes. His work includes facilitating complex multi-party disputes and negotiated rulemaking, especially in collaboration with intergovernmental agencies and Native American tribes. Mr. Swanson holds a master’s degree in Conflict Management and an undergraduate degree in Cultural Anthropology, both from George Mason University.
